    All Sno-Isle branches were closed in March 2020 due to the COVID-19 pandemic, but reopened with curbside pick-up service three months later. [18] In-person services resumed at some branches in early 2021. [19] In 2024, the city government of Everett proposed a consolidation of their city libraries with Sno-Isle to address a budget deficit. [20]

    Snohomish's public library is operated by Sno-Isle Libraries, a regional system that annexed the city-run library. Located near downtown, the 23,000-square-foot (2,100 m 2 ) building is the third-largest in the Sno-Isle system and serves over 5,000 weekly patrons.

    Granite Falls has a public library that is operated by the regional Sno-Isle Libraries system, which annexed the city in 1995. [74] The 6,500-square-foot (600 m 2) library building is located east of downtown Granite Falls and was initially owned by the city government until it was transferred to Sno-Isle in 2012. [75] [76]

    A 5,055-square-foot (469.6 m 2) library near downtown Arlington opened on June 28, 1981, and holds over 54,000 items. [52]: 9–12 It was originally owned by the city government and was transferred to Sno-Isle in 2021 as part of preparations for a renovation, [145] which had been planned since the 2000s.
